Output 7418425280aef2e7d8b69c2ce6da6129be8bd305241ae193a6eee6891bce9b6f:0

value
7057000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5d5be9ec8f5086716ec732c3e4a7098d02e0946 OP_EQUAL
address
MP21nKQKqx8LHsjy4TfcXKiasrCaH1dpgE
transaction
7418425280aef2e7d8b69c2ce6da6129be8bd305241ae193a6eee6891bce9b6f
spent
true